 ### Functions argument description
 
 - `filename` is the name of a file to read for functions `plotter.plot, plotter.plot_contour, plotter.avg_plot` and the template of filenames for the function `plotter.ani_plot`
+- `ndim` is the dimensionality of the data contained in `filename`
 - `out` is the output directory to save a function result 
 - `oname` is the output name of a function result
 - `var` is a list or a single variable denoting names(name) to process (may be got from `plotter.dump` function)

+### Get data from file 
+```python
+plotter.get_data(filename, ndim)
+```
+
+Positional arguments:
+1. string $`filename`$
+2. int $`ndim`$
+
+Function returns data contained in file `filename` as a dictionary with key values as variables names.

+### Plotting difference of N-d data
+```python
+plotter.plot_diff(filename, ndim)
+```
+Function saves plots of the subtraction of the data contained in `filename[1]` from the data contained in `filename[0]` into the *out/oname* file.
+
+Positional arguments:
+1. [string] $`filename`$
+2. int $`ndim`$
+
+Optional arguments:
+1. string $`out`$
+2. string or [string] $`oname`$
+3. string or [string] $`var`$
+4. float or [float] $`mval`$
